Имя: Пароль:
1C
 
Запуск батника выгрузки базы из другой базы )
0 Demetry
 
28.09.20
14:57
Есть батник с командой выгрузки базы в dt. В обработке след базы пишу
    Команда = "runas /savecred /user:PC\Дмитрий c:\1.cmd";
    ЗапуститьПриложение(Команда,,Истина,КодВозврата);

Ошибок не выдает , но  и выгрузку не делает. Если запускать батник в виндос то все норм. Уже с админскими правами запускаю из под 1С все рано не помогает. Чет бы еще сделать ?
1 polosov
 
28.09.20
15:00
Кириллические символы есть в 1.cmd?
2 Demetry
 
28.09.20
15:00
нету
"C:\Program Files (x86)\1cv8\8.3.13.1644\BIN\1CV8.EXE" DESIGNER  /F C:Avalon /DumpIB c:\1\58.dt
3 acht
 
28.09.20
15:05
Клиент/Сервер?
4 acht
 
28.09.20
15:06
И кстати, как ты батник запускаешь - напрямую, или через "runas /savecred /user:PC\Дмитрий c:\1.cmd" ?
5 acht
 
28.09.20
15:06
Вне 1С когда
6 Demetry
 
28.09.20
15:09
И так и так , делает выгрузку.
7 Demetry
 
28.09.20
15:20
C:Avalon , забыл \  поставить.)))
С ручного запуска норм отрабатывает , а вот с 1С уже нет.
Всем спасибо за участие.
8 ДенисЧ
 
28.09.20
15:21
(2) А где юзверь?
9 acht
 
28.09.20
15:25
(8) Судя по всему, он хочет авторизацию windows, для чего все это и затеял
10 Йохохо
 
28.09.20
15:49
а так "runas /savecred /user:PC\Дмитрий c:\1\1.cmd &2>&1 >> C:\1\log.txt & start c:\1\log.txt"
мог где то ошибиться в синтаксисе, 1 надо создать
Закон Брукера: Даже маленькая практика стоит большой теории.